**Q: Why does the Millbrand Bakery platform reject orders after the cutoff, and how do we recover an override account?**

A: The Ovenline service enforces a hard 15:00 cutoff for next-day orders to protect the baking schedule. Release managers occasionally need the override account to test cutoff changes in staging. If that account locks, recovery goes through the Ovenline admin console, which requires the recovery passphrase. That passphrase appears on the line below.

recovery phrase for fawif-tajeg: norael-aldmir-casir-brivan-ulaion

// SHARD_COUNT governs how Pellwright's user-profile store is partitioned.
// External plugin authors: never derive shard indexes yourself — always
// call the routing helper, since the hash salt rotates per deployment
// epoch and raw modulo arithmetic will silently target the wrong shard.
// Changing this constant requires a full rebalance window approved by
// the storage council. The constant was last validated against the
// deployment identified by the trace token below.

session token of tajog-fahaf = htk21_4ae55819f45410afcb307

Q3 Planning Note — Finance Team

Sale of the Draymill Coatings unit proceeds on schedule. Buyer diligence closes month-end. Book the unit as held-for-sale; freeze capex immediately. Transition costs capped per the steering memo. Expect one-off advisory fees in Q3, proceeds in Q4. Do not discuss externally. The confidential business note appears directly below this line.

internal memo for kawip-hadug: Headcount on the Wenwyn team goes from 7 to 140 by the end of January. Gross margin on Wenwyn came in at 20 percent against a plan of 15 percent.

## FreshFold Locker Access — Release Checklist

Quick reminder before you ship: the locker-open flow hits the Latchline service twice — once to reserve the door, once to confirm pickup. If either call fails, the locker stays shut and support gets angry pings, so smoke-test both paths on staging first. The staging environment doesn't share prod credentials; it talks to Latchline with its own key, which is as follows.

API key for yahig-tadup: kto7_ubizbYm